Finance Specialist

Procter & GambleDubai, United Arab EmiratesPosted 19 May 2026

Procter & Gamble is hiring a Finance and Accounting Analyst in Dubai for their general office. This role involves conducting financial analyses, supporting site governance, and ensuring policy compliance. Candidates should have a bachelor's degree in finance or accounting and proficiency in MS Office tools. It is an entry-level position focused on building analytical skills within a global consumer goods organization.
